我在matlab中有一个叫做mystruct的结构。
它有以下字段和以下类:
Field Class
a single
b single
c double
我想将mystruct的所有字段转换为double类,但当我尝试时:
double(mystruct)
我从MATLAB中得到以下输出:
??? Error using ==> double
Conversion to double from struct is not possible.
此外,我只是以mystruct为例。我意识到我可以单独手动转换每个字段,因为在这个例子中只有3个字段。我
我们正在构建一个工具(供内部使用),它只有在从源代码中删除javax.persistence.GeneratedValue注释时才能工作(我们在工具中设置Id,由于GeneratedValue注释而被拒绝)……但对于正常操作,我们需要此注释。
如何在运行时删除Java Annotation (可能使用反射)?
这是我的班级:
@Entity
public class PersistentClass{
@Id
@GeneratedValue(strategy = GenerationType.AUTO)
private long id;
// ... Other data
}
我知道,从Go 1.8开始,就可以将一个结构分配给另一个结构类型,如下所示:
func example() { type T1 struct { X intjson:"foo“} type T2 struct { X intjson:"bar”} var v1 T1 var v2 T2 v1 = T1(v2) // now legal }
但是,如果结构内部有一个字段作为另一个结构,它就不能工作。
操场:
除了手动分配每个字段之外,在这种情况下分配2个结构的最佳方法是什么?
这不是的副本,因为在这里,您将一
虽然我们有重命名结构字段的重构工具,但我们没有删除结构字段的重构工具&它的用法。 如何从支持golang的集成开发环境中安全地删除struct字段及其跨文件的usagesWrite & read访问权限? 据我所知,没有一个IDE(vim-go,intellij)支持这一点。 我曾经想过要删除struct字段& run go vet 它将返回每个文件上的所有错误(以及行号)&编写一个脚本来删除这些行,但不幸的是,在文件中遇到第一个错误后,vet停止报告错误。
我有两张红移表-- t1和t2。
t2已经包含了30万条记录。
t1包含10 000条记录。
我需要根据t1字段从t2中删除已经存在于id中的所有记录。
为了做到这一点,我将执行以下查询(其中之一):
DELETE FROM t1 WHERE id IN(SELECT id FROM t2);
或
DELETE FROM t1 USING t2 WHERE t1.id = t2.ud;
或
DELETE FROM t1 WHERE EXISTS (SELECT 1 FROM t2 WHERE t1.id = t2.id);
在对实际数据进行处理之前,我想问一下--从性能的角度来看,在Reds
我正在使用C#实体框架为一个项目将数据映射到sql server。我正在尝试一种方法,可以使用实体框架根据鉴别器字段自动生成自定义子类,而不要求子类实体具有表。
示例:
在实体框架中,我有一个对象A,它有一个字段type。我还提供了以下内容
public class B : A {
}
public class C : A {
}
我正在寻找一种方法,使实体框架能够识别type字段,例如B,然后创建B类的一个实例。这些类没有需要持久化到数据库的数据。它们只是不同表中行的包装器。
示例:
我有一个包含item对象的表。每个item对象都有一个item设置集合和一个item类型字段。
有不同类型
如果我有下面的类:
classdef foo
properties
bar1
bar2
bar3
end
properties(Access = private)
bar4
bar5
end
end
并执行以下操作:
myObj = foo();
test = struct(myObj);
test将foo的所有5个属性作为字段,包括私有属性:
test =
bar1: NaN
bar2: NaN
bar3: NaN
我正在尝试将spark输出的parquet文件从S3加载到雅典娜。镶木地板的结构是这个[StructField(URI,StringType,true), StructField(LINK_ID,LongType,true)]。所以有两个字段,第一个是string,第二个是long。我正在尝试将这个镶木地板加载到一个表中,而我正在努力加载类型为long的第二个字段。雅典娜给我的整数选项是tinyint、int和bigint。我本以为bigint会起作用,但它并没有。当我查询表时,第二个字段是空的。
下面是用于创建表的整个查询:
CREATE EXTERNAL TABLE IF NOT EXIS
我在Lucene中使用Sitecore,并尝试对一个整型字段进行刻面,这样我就可以获得该字段的所有现有值。我有以下搜索结果类,其中包含字段的定义:
public class ContentTypeSearchResultItem : Sitecore.ContentSearch.SearchTypes.SearchResultItem
{
[Sitecore.ContentSearch.IndexField("crop_heat_units")]
public int CropHeatUnits { get; set; }
}
在我的查询中,我有
query =